This valuable property consisting of approximately 50 acres is located midway between Lismore & Ballina & is only 4km from Alstonville, on the much sought after rich volcanic soil of the Alstonville Plateau.
The well maintained home set in spacious surrounds offer privacy from the surrounding area & enjoy an abundance of bird-life & fauna including koalas. The property has all weather access.
With over 5000 trees planted ranging in age from just starting to bare to mature (all trees are high kernel recovery varieties) . This well laid out farm with it’s very modern & highly organised de-husking & sorting equipment will make handling such a large crop very manageable & efficient. All of the land is flat ensuring safe, efficient machinery operation.
A large, state of the art, computer controlled nut drying facility has been built that allows control over the de-husking, drying & sorting process of the crop. Regardless of the weather, field moisture from the nuts can be continually removed at the recommended 2%/day, to a pre-determined level to allow accurate sorting & importantly, to retain maximum quality.
The facility consists of 7 bins to allow segregation by variety, with a total capacity of 30-35 tons.
This system gives full control, is cost efficient, labour saving & maximises profits.
Along with well-maintained machinery, there are two large sheds, one with full worker facilities.
The farm also comes with an valuable 40ML irrigation licence (bore) & a large dam .
